centos

centos清理系统更新残留的方法

小樊
43
2025-04-14 19:40:37
栏目: 智能运维

在 CentOS 系统中,可以通过以下几种方法来清理系统更新残留:

清理 YUM 更新日志文件

YUM(Yellowdog Updater Modified)是 CentOS 中的包管理器,用于管理软件包。更新操作会在 /var/log/yum.log 文件中留下记录。可以使用以下命令来清理这些日志文件:

cat /dev/null > /var/log/yum.log

这条命令会将 /var/log/yum.log 文件清空,从而释放磁盘空间。

清理临时文件

系统更新过程中可能会产生临时文件,这些文件通常位于 /tmp 目录下。可以使用以下命令来清理这些临时文件:

yum clean all

这条命令会清理 YUM 缓存和临时文件,释放磁盘空间。

手动删除更新安装目录

有时更新安装后会在 /usr/lib/python2.7/site-packages 或其他目录下留下残留文件。可以手动删除这些目录:

rm -rf /usr/lib/python2.7/site-packages/*

请注意,在执行此操作之前,请确保这些目录确实包含更新残留文件,以免误删重要文件。

使用磁盘清理工具

虽然 CentOS 默认的磁盘清理工具不如 Windows 的磁盘清理工具功能强大,但仍然可以使用 yum-utils 包中的 yum-clean 命令来清理缓存:

sudo yum install yum-utils
sudo yum clean all

这条命令会清理 YUM 缓存,包括已下载的软件包和缓存文件。

注意事项

通过上述方法,可以有效清理 CentOS 系统更新残留,释放磁盘空间。

0
看了该问题的人还看了